## Formula sandbox tuning

User-supplied formulas in Gridmoor execute inside a restricted interpreter with hard ceilings on time, memory, and call depth. Reviewers should confirm any change to these ceilings is justified in the PR description, since raising them widens the abuse surface. Defaults were chosen from production traces. The current limits are as follows.

limits module of tafog-fawip:
WEIGHTS = {
    "julix": 57,
    "lamys": 992,
    "kasvan": 209,
    "quenok": 750,
    "alddor": 259,
    "oliath": 1009,
    "wenix": 815,
}

**Service Accounts: Build Agent Clock Skew**

The Fernhollow build agents occasionally drift more than 30 seconds, which causes the Tallgrass token service to reject signed requests from the release pipeline. Until NTP hardening lands, the release manager should use the long-lived skew-tolerant account instead. Authenticate the promotion job with the key below.

gateway credential: kto3_qfe

Handover note — Crumbwheel order cutoffs.

Welcome aboard. The bakery cutoff rule in Crumbwheel closes same-day orders at 14:00 local to each storefront, not UTC — this has bitten us twice. Holiday overrides live in the calendar service and take precedence silently, so always check there first when a cutoff looks wrong. To unlock the calendar service's admin console after a restart, enter the recovery passphrase below.

vault phrase of bagap-bahaf = silion-pelox-sorox-casdor-quenwyn-fraax-eliox-praael-kelion-quenvan-kasox-rusael-norius-belvan

To: release channel. Subject: cutoff rule fix. The Crumbline order-cutoff rule was comparing times in the shop's timezone against UTC order timestamps, so late-evening orders in western regions slipped past the 2pm next-day cutoff. Patched to normalize both sides before comparing. Backfilled the twelve affected orders; bakeries notified. Shipping tonight, no migration needed. Please glance at the cutoff dashboard tomorrow morning. The candidate build for tonight's deploy is listed below.

trace token, fafog-kageg: htk4_98e6